Sadie Fund

Sadie Fund is a program that S.P.O.T. inherited in 2001. The program was orignally founded by a local couple who felt the need to help financially support other local residents in need of veterinary care for their pets.

The Sadie Fund is funded by earmarked funds by S.P.O.T., Donation boxes located at area veterinary clinics, and Donations from the public.

S.P.O.T. has kept the fund going and has helped thousands of families with their emergency veterinary needs. The medical needs are limited to non spay/neuter and annual check-up needs. It is intended for emergency situtaions.

If you find yourself in need of financial assistance, ask your veterinarian about the Sadie Fund Program.
